Kittery Point- Matthew "Matt" Arthur McLaughlin, 51, from Kittery Point, Maine passed away peacefully in his home on January 5, 2024, after complications following a heart transplant in 2019.
Matt was the beloved son of Sharon M. Lynch McLaughlin and the late Edwards Roberts of Kittery Point, and son of David and Priscilla McLaughlin of Sherborn, Massachusetts. He was a brother of D. Michael McLaughlin and his fiancée Lynda Dennerly of Bow, New Hampshire and Beth and Dean Perkins of Exeter, New Hampshire. He was an uncle to Aidan Kelly and Tate and Coleman Perkins. Matt was a nephew to the late Daniel and Rose Lynch, the late Virgil Lynch and surviving wife Doris, the late Phillip and Gloria Lynch, Dale and Nancy Lynch, Pamela and David Waitt, Jane McLaughlin Burg, Barbara Coleman, and Diane and Dale Chalmers. He was the grandson of the late Freda Grant Lynch and James Lynch and Alice and Clarence Thompson.
Matt was born in Boston Massachusetts and grew up in Woburn, Massachusetts. He graduated from Woburn High School in 1990. As a boy, he loved riding and racing BMX bikes. He won many trophies racing BMX. Matt was always incredibly strong and broke the weight lifting record while a student at the Kennedy Junior High School. After high school, Matt dedicated hours to body building. He won the overall Teen National Championships in West Palm Beach, Florida in 1992. He finished First Place in the North American Light Heavy Weight division in Tijuana, Mexico in 1993.
Matt did demolition work as a young man. For the last twenty five years he has made his home in Kittery Point, where he enjoyed being self employed selling old toys, which he took great pride in finding. He loved giving them as gifts to his family members. Matt was a generous friend, and always willing to help his friends out. He was kind and had a great sense of humor. His cardiologist described him as a gentle soul. Matt demonstrated great strength and resilience during these last few years, especially during this past year, when he spent over ninety days at Massachusetts General Hospital. He will be forever missed.
